The Hypersonic Challenge: Data Velocity Meets Decision Latency

Hypersonic weapon systems compress engagement timelines to mere seconds. Effective response demands real-time command coordination across land, air, maritime, cyber, and space domains.

At this tempo, command nodes must process, visualize, and act on data without delay or compromise.
